How Common Is The Last Name Maričić? popularity and diffusion

Maričić is the 106,699th most numerous surname worldwide, borne by approximately 1 in 1,664,203 people. The surname is predominantly found in Europe, where 100 percent of Maričić are found; 100 percent are found in Southeastern Europe and 100 percent are found in South Slavic Europe.

The surname is most numerous in Serbia, where it is held by 2,620 people, or 1 in 2,727. In Serbia Maričić is primarily found in: Belgrade, where 21 percent live, Moravica District, where 15 percent live and South Bačka District, where 13 percent live. Not including Serbia Maričić is found in 8 countries. It also occurs in Croatia, where 20 percent live and Bosnia and Herzegovina, where 17 percent live.
